当前位置: 首页 > news >正文

自助建站系统源码 资源网吉祥又聚财的公司名字

自助建站系统源码 资源网,吉祥又聚财的公司名字,宁波妇科,意大利新闻简介#xff1a; CSDN博客专家#xff0c;专注Android/Linux系统#xff0c;分享多mic语音方案、音视频、编解码等技术#xff0c;与大家一起成长#xff01; 优质专栏#xff1a;Audio工程师进阶系列【原创干货持续更新中……】#x1f680; 人生格言#xff1a; 人生… 简介 CSDN博客专家专注Android/Linux系统分享多mic语音方案、音视频、编解码等技术与大家一起成长 优质专栏Audio工程师进阶系列【原创干货持续更新中……】 人生格言 人生从来没有捷径只有行动才是治疗恐惧和懒惰的唯一良药. 更多原创,欢迎关注Android系统攻城狮 1.前言 本篇目的理解C之lambda匿名函数、typedef、using等用法 2.C11的enum class与传统的enum关键字介绍 C11引入的enum class关键字来定义枚举传统的enum关键字定义枚举 作用范围enum class创建了一个作用域限定的枚举类型而enum则创建了一个隐式的全局作用域枚举类型。这意味着使用enum class定义的枚举成员在枚举之外是不可见的需要通过作用域解析运算符::来访问。 默认类型安全性enum class提供了更严格的类型安全性不允许隐式的整数转换。它们不能与整数类型进行直接比较或赋值操作必须使用显式的类型转换。 枚举成员的作用域在enum class中定义的枚举成员在枚举之外是不可见的因此可以使用相同名称的枚举成员在不同的枚举中进行定义。 总结enum class提供了更严格的类型安全性和作用域隔离的特性能够避免命名冲突和隐式类型转换的问题。而传统的enum关键字则更为灵活但类型安全性、作用域限定方面相对较弱。 3.代码实例 1.传统enum枚举例子 v1.0 #include iostreamenum Color {RED,GREEN,BLUE };int main() {Color c GREEN;if(c RED) {std::cout 颜色是红色 std::endl;} else if(c GREEN) {std::cout 颜色是绿色 std::endl;} else if(c BLUE) {std::cout 颜色是蓝色 std::endl;}return 0; }v2.0 #include iostreamenum Descriptor : int32_t {Invalid 0,NUM01 1 };int main(){//1.将enum class Descriptor枚举类型转换成int32_t类型Descriptor descriptor Descriptor::NUM01;int32_t value static_castint32_t(descriptor);printf(value %d\n,value);//2.将int32_t类型转换成enum class Descriptor枚举类型类型int number 23;Descriptor desc1 static_castDescriptor(number);printf(number %d\n,number); } 2.C11引入enum class枚举例子 v1.0 #include iostreamenum class Color {RED,GREEN,BLUE };int main() {Color c Color::GREEN;if(c Color::RED) {std::cout 颜色是红色 std::endl;} else if(c Color::GREEN) {std::cout 颜色是绿色 std::endl;} else if(c Color::BLUE) {std::cout 颜色是蓝色 std::endl;}return 0; }v2.0 #include iostreamenum class Descriptor : int32_t {Invalid 0,NUM01 1 };int main(){//1.将enum class Descriptor枚举类型转换成int32_t类型Descriptor descriptor Descriptor::NUM01;int32_t value static_castint32_t(descriptor);printf(value %d\n,value);//2.将int32_t类型转换成enum class Descriptor枚举类型类型int number 23;Descriptor desc1 static_castDescriptor(number);printf(number %d\n,number); }
http://www.yingshimen.cn/news/20151/

相关文章:

  • 网上做兼职网站正规做网站 就上微赞网
  • 克隆网站首页做单页站几个文件网站创建需要多少钱
  • 重庆市建设工程安全网站wordpress如何配置文件
  • 建设旅行网站在哪个网站注册域名好
  • 做网站义乌云尚网络建站
  • 常州网站建设公司咨询最专业网站建设
  • 做网站的毕设开题依据商鼎营销型网站建设
  • 怎么做查询网站吗西安网页搭建
  • 找做玻璃的网站苏州建网站收费
  • 长春网站设计外包百度小说排行榜2019
  • 安装网站系统重庆电商网站
  • 网站建设是前端么网站建设的要点是什么意思
  • 营销运营主要做什么梅州seo
  • 桥东区网站建设wordpress 文章背景色
  • 佛山响应式网站公司中国建设银行官方网
  • 网站加入我们页面网站备案管局电话
  • 有没有高质量的网站都懂的公司可以备案几个网站
  • 衡水做企业网站的价格10个网站做站群
  • 网站建设提成微网站ui多少钱
  • 做外贸需要建英文网站吗西安黄页
  • 万户网站建设公司遵义网站建设托管公司
  • 直播课网站怎样做的网页设计个人主页模板图片
  • wordpress前端登录插件关于seo的行业岗位有哪些
  • php做的购物网站系统下载运营哪里学的比较专业
  • 做网站找哪个软件用邮箱做网站
  • 菜篮网网站开发技术南京网站建设南京
  • 制作微信公众号的网站查询网站whois
  • 江西网站建设技术类似稿定设计的网站
  • 做网站的框架做网站收入
  • 广东广州重大新闻模版网站可以做seo吗